Festival of the Spoken Nerd is a UK comedy group (akin to Chicago's
Second City or the old SNL Not Ready for Prime Time Players). They
produced a DVD this year, "Full Frontal Nerdity", based on their tour
in 2014. It contains Klingon subtitles, including a few words that
were not previously known to the Klingon-speaking community. They have
been verified as authentic. The content is not available online; if
you want a copy of the DVD you can order it online.

The few Klingon words invented for/revealed by the FFN DVD are listed
in a message from Maltz forwarded to the tlhIngan-Hol email discussion
forum by De'vID on April 30, 2015. The list archives have not yet been
brought up to date, so I can't provide a link to the relevant post and
the discussion which followed. But you can always look at the New
Words List /about-klingon/new-klingon-words/ for
such things. The FFN words were all added March 31, except for one
that was made public two weeks earlier.
